What is Lidocaine Powder?

Lidocaine, chemically known as 2-(diethylamino)-N-(2,6-dimethylphenyl)acetamide, has the molecular formula C14H22N2O. It appears as a white crystalline powder with a high degree of purity typically exceeding 98-99%. Lidocaine serves primarily as a local anesthetic, providing temporary numbness to specific body areas to facilitate minor surgical procedures or diagnostic interventions. Apart from topical anesthesia, lidocaine is also utilized as an antiarrhythmic agent to stabilize irregular heart rhythms.

Physically, lidocaine powder is stable, soluble in water and several pharmaceutical solvents, and melts around 66-69 °C. These properties support its role as an active pharmaceutical ingredient (API) in various drug formulations like injectable solutions, topical gels, patches, sprays, and creams. Its pharmaceutical-grade purity ensures consistent therapeutic efficacy and safety in clinical use.

The Concept of "Rock Up" in Drug Powders

The phrase "rock up" refers to the process of converting powdered substances into hard, rock-like crystalline solids. This term is mostly associated with illicit drug production, particularly the manufacture of crack cocaine. Crack cocaine is produced by chemically treating cocaine hydrochloride powder with baking soda and heat, transforming it into a less soluble free base that solidifies into irregular "rocks." These rocks are easier to handle for street-level distribution and are smoked for rapid onset of effects.

This process and terminology, however, do not apply to pharmaceutical compounds like lidocaine. Lidocaine powder is never processed into rock-like forms for consumption or distribution in any legitimate medical, pharmaceutical, or industrial context.

Why Lidocaine Powder Does Not Rock Up

There are several fundamental reasons why lidocaine powder does not and cannot "rock up" into crystalline rocks similar to crack cocaine:

- Pharmaceutical Manufacturing Standards: Lidocaine is produced under strict pharmaceutical conditions adhering to good manufacturing practice (GMP) guidelines. The powder is designed for further formulation into solutions or topical products, and the purity, particle size, and other parameters are tightly controlled to ensure safety and predictable pharmacological effects.

- Chemical Properties: Lidocaine's chemical structure and physical characteristics do not favor formation into durable, smokable rocks. Unlike cocaine, lidocaine lacks the free base conversion properties that lead to solid "rocks" during chemical processing.

- Medical Usage: Lidocaine's intended use is targeted, localized anesthesia or cardiac arrhythmia control, requiring it to remain in powder or solution form suitable for precise dosing. Conversion into rock-like forms would compromise dosing accuracy and safety.

- Lack of Recreational Use: Lidocaine does not have any psychoactive or euphoric effects associated with drugs like cocaine. Therefore, there is no incentive or practical purpose behind converting it into a "rock" for smoking or illicit abuse.

Applications of Lidocaine Powder in Medicine

Lidocaine powder is an indispensable pharmaceutical raw material. Upon transformation into end-use products, its applications include:

- Local Anesthesia: Lidocaine is the standard agent used to numb tissues before procedures such as dental surgeries, biopsies, minor excisions, and cutaneous treatments. It temporarily blocks sodium channels in nerve cells, preventing pain signal conduction.

- Antiarrhythmic Agent: In cardiology, lidocaine administration helps to manage ventricular arrhythmias by stabilizing cardiac electrical activity.

- Topical Analgesia: Lidocaine-containing creams, gels, and sprays provide localized relief for minor skin irritations, burns, insect bites, and neuropathic pain.

- Formulation Versatility: Lidocaine powder is the starting material for numerous pharmaceutical preparations including injectable solutions, transdermal patches, oropharyngeal sprays, and compounded creams.

Manufacturing and Quality Control

Manufacturing lidocaine powder involves strict quality assurance processes:

- Ensuring raw material sourcing from reliable suppliers compliant with chemical and pharmaceutical standards.

- Maintaining purity levels typically above 98-99% to avoid contaminants which could affect efficacy or cause adverse reactions.

- Storing powder in cool, dry environments shielded from light and humidity to preserve chemical stability.

- Conducting rigorous testing such as High-Performance Liquid Chromatography (HPLC), melting point analysis, and impurity profiling as per pharmacopoeia requirements.

These measures ensure that lidocaine powder supplied for medical production meets regulatory standards, ensuring safety for patients and healthcare professionals.

Safety Considerations and Handling

While lidocaine is generally safe when used properly, improper use or exposure can cause adverse effects:

- Overdose or accidental intravenous injection of large amounts may lead to systemic toxicity such as CNS excitation or cardiovascular depression.

- Allergic reactions, although rare, may occur in sensitive individuals.

- Handling of raw lidocaine powder requires appropriate laboratory safety protocols including personal protective equipment, proper ventilation, and avoidance of inhalation or skin contact.

Pharmaceutical producers who use lidocaine powder as an API should maintain standard operating procedures (SOPs) for safe handling and quality control.
